Monitoring of fluid waste concentrates on finding a way to throw away the waste in such a way that is risk-free for people and the environment.
The basic requirements anticipated from a human waste (excreta) disposal technique are: Surface water have to not be polluted. There must be no contamination of groundwater that may, subsequently, contaminate springtimes or wells. Excreta needs to not come to flies or other animals. There need to be no handling of excreta; where this is inescapable, it ought to be maintained to a minimum.
The technique made use of need to be easy and inexpensive in building and procedure. In Study Session 18 you were presented to some of the hygiene modern technologies that are made use of for human waste monitoring.
